Defining and Understanding Smart Homes
Smart homes embody the perfect blend of technology and convenience. An array of smart devices and automation systems collaborate to elevate your living experience.
Imagine enhanced energy efficiency, improved security, and seamless connectivity all working together.
Smart homes let you control appliances remotely through internet-connected devices, crafting a modern living environment that emphasizes personalized experiences and real-time energy monitoring.
At the heart of this transformation are smart thermostats, like the Google Nest Mini, which adjust heating and cooling based on your habits. This not only optimizes energy use but also ensures your comfort is prioritized.
Similarly, smart lighting systems allow you to customize brightness and color settings, creating the perfect ambiance for any occasion.
These devices communicate effortlessly through home automation systems, enhancing overall functionality.
For instance, when you integrate the Ring Smart Doorbell, you not only boost your security with real-time alerts but also trigger smart lights to illuminate when someone approaches your door.
This connection guarantees that every component within your smart home contributes to a user-friendly experience, redefining convenience and lifestyle.

Cost Savings
Investing in smart home technology can lead to significant cost savings, primarily through enhanced energy efficiency and intelligent management of your energy consumption.
By harnessing advanced algorithms and learning capabilities, smart thermostats adjust your home’s heating and cooling based on your schedules and preferences.
This technology gives you the power to maintain an ideal temperature without excessive energy use, as the system adapts to fluctuations in weather and your daily activities.
As a result, you’ll not only enjoy a comfortable living environment but also witness a notable reduction in energy waste, which can translate into lower monthly utility bills.
Over time, the financial benefits become strikingly clear; these smart devices effectively pay for themselves through reduced energy expenditures, showcasing the long-term savings that come with adopting more efficient energy solutions.

Security and Privacy Concerns
Security and privacy should be at the forefront of your mind as you explore smart home technology, particularly with the rise of smart cameras and locks that are always watching and documenting your surroundings. As these devices weave themselves deeper into your everyday life, the risks associated with them grow, especially the potential for cybercriminals to gain unauthorized access by exploiting software vulnerabilities.
Data breaches can lay bare your sensitive information. This is why it s essential for you to set strong passwords and keep your device firmware up to date. Staying vigilant about security alerts can prompt you to act quickly and neutralize potential threats.
To bolster your protection, consider these strategies:
- Install network segmentation to keep different devices on separate networks.
- Disable unnecessary features.
- Utilize encryption methods.
Each of these steps plays a vital role in safeguarding your personal data and preserving your privacy in an increasingly interconnected world.
Technological Limitations
Technological limitations in smart home systems can pose significant challenges for you, especially regarding connectivity and compatibility among various devices, whether they rely on hardwired or wireless systems.
You may often find yourself grappling with Wi-Fi range issues, where certain areas of your home experience weak signals or frequent drops. This can lead to frustration when you’re trying to control your devices.
Interference from other Wi-Fi networks or electronic devices can complicate your experience even further. Integrating devices from different manufacturers can also lead to compatibility headaches, as not all products are built to work seamlessly together.
To address these challenges, you might consider:
- Install Wi-Fi extenders.
- Choose a robust mesh network to enhance your coverage.
- Select devices that follow common standards, like Zigbee or Z-Wave, to facilitate smoother integration among your diverse range of products.

What exactly is a smart home?
A smart home is a residence that uses internet-connected devices for the remote monitoring and management of appliances and systems, such as lighting, heating, and security. It’s a form of home automation, which means using technology to control home devices easily, giving homeowners control over their household systems through a central control unit or a smartphone app.

Are there any downsides to having a smart home?
One potential downside of smart homes is the initial cost of installation and setup. Smart devices can be more expensive than traditional ones, and homeowners may need to invest in additional technology, such as a central control unit or smart hub.
Additionally, there may be security concerns with having multiple internet-connected devices in the home, although these risks can be mitigated through proper security measures.
